MGI Phenotype |
FUNCTION: This gene encodes an enzyme involved in the conversion of arachidonic acid to 12R-hydroxyeicosatetraenoic acid. Mutations in this gene can prevent the formation of the epidermal permeability barrier and cause an ichthyosiform phenotype. [provided by RefSeq, Sep 2015] PHENOTYPE: Neonatal homozygous mutant mice exhibit reddened skin that quickly dehydrates and appears scaly. The epidermis is hyperkeratotic, and its permeability barrier function is compromised. Homozygotes die within 24 hours of birth. [provided by MGI curators]
